Career Path
Cloud Support Engineer
Specializes in troubleshooting and maintaining cloud infrastructure, ensuring seamless business operations.
Cloud Solutions Architect
Designs scalable cloud solutions tailored to business needs, optimizing performance and cost-efficiency.
DevOps Engineer
Integrates development and operations to streamline cloud deployment and improve business agility.
